Valentyna Fedorchuk-Moroz is a researcher at the forefront of integrating computer vision with fire safety engineering. Her work primarily focuses on developing intelligent, vision-based systems for early fire detection and suppression, addressing critical challenges in both computer science and engineering domains. Her most notable contribution is the comprehensive review, "Review of Advances in Fire Extinguishing Based on Computer Vision Applications: Methods, Challenges, and Future Directions," which has already garnered attention with 2 citations shortly after its 2025 publication. This seminal paper employs a rigorous two-stage bibliographic analysis to map the evolving landscape of fire suppression technologies, systematically evaluating methods, identifying persistent challenges, and charting promising future directions. By synthesizing a wide array of publications, Fedorchuk-Moroz provides a crucial roadmap for researchers and engineers seeking to enhance fire safety through automated, vision-driven solutions.
